What You’ll Do

• Provide companionship and personal care
 • Assist with daily living activities and mobility
 • Help maintain a safe and comfortable home environment
 • Monitor and communicate changes in client condition
 • Work closely with families and the care team
 • Help seniors remain independent while providing peace of mind to families

Qualifications

• Must be at least 18 years old
 • Compassionate, dependable, and patient attitude
 • Valid driver’s license, reliable transportation, and auto insurance required
 • Ability to pass a background check and provide references
 • Experience is helpful, but not required — paid training provided
